Таким образом в файле news.php можно принять переданные значения, например:
- из адреса http://домен/news/novost_odin в $_GET[‘path’] будет novost_odin
- из адреса http://домен/news/?page=2 в $_GET[‘path’] ничего не будет, а в $_GET[‘page’] будет 2
- из адреса http://домен/news/novost_odin/?page=5 в $_GET[‘path’] будет novost_odin/, в $_GET[‘page’] будет 5
Как принудительно использовать HTTPS с помощью .htaccess
15.12.20202020-12-15T01:57:15+03:002021-01-14T13:26:25+03:00 Linux Комментариев нет
Если вы установили сертификат SSL для своего домена, следующим шагом должна быть настройка приложения для обслуживания всего веб-трафика через HTTPS.
В отличие от HTTP, где запросы и ответы отправляются и возвращаются в виде открытого текста, HTTPS использует TLS / SSL для шифрования связи между клиентом и сервером.
Использование HTTPS по сравнению с HTTP дает несколько преимуществ, например:
- Все данные зашифрованы в обоих направлениях. В результате конфиденциальная информация не может быть прочитана в случае перехвата.
- Chrome, Firefox и все другие популярные браузеры помечают ваш сайт как безопасный.
- HTTPS позволяет использовать протокол HTTP / 2, что значительно повышает производительность сайта.
- Google отдает предпочтение HTTPS-сайтам. Ваш сайт будет лучше ранжироваться, если обслуживается через HTTPS.
Перенаправление может быть установлено на уровне приложения или сервера. В этой статье объясняется, как перенаправить HTTP-трафик на HTTPS с помощью файла .htaccess
.
Если у вас есть root-доступ по SSH к серверу Linux, на котором работает Apache, предпочтительным способом является настройка перенаправления в файле конфигурации виртуального хоста домена. В противном случае вы можете настроить перенаправление в файле . htaccess
домена. Сервер Apache читает файл .htaccess
при каждом запросе страницы, что замедляет работу веб-сервера.
Большинство панелей управления, например cPanel, позволяют принудительно перенаправлять HTTPS с помощью графического пользовательского интерфейса.
Содержание
Перенаправить HTTP на HTTPS с помощью
.htaccess
.htaccess
— это файл конфигурации для каждого каталога веб-сервера Apache. Этот файл используется для определения того, как Apache обслуживает файлы из каталога, в котором он размещен, а также для включения / отключения дополнительных функций.
Как правило, файл .htaccess
находится в корневом каталоге домена, но в подкаталогах могут быть и другие файлы .htaccess
.
Вы можете отредактировать файл .htaccess
(или создать новый) через SSH или FTP.
Чтобы перенаправить HTTP-запросы на HTTPS, откройте файл
и добавьте следующий код:
RewriteEngine On RewriteCond %{HTTPS} off RewriteRule ^(. (.*)$ https://www.example.com/$1 [R=301,L]
Выводы
Мы показали вам, как отредактировать файл .htaccess
чтобы перенаправить весь HTTP-трафик на HTTPS.
Если у вас есть доступ к файлам конфигурации Apache, для повышения производительности вы должны принудительно использовать HTTPS, создав 301 редирект на виртуальном хосте домена.
Если у вас есть какие-либо вопросы или отзывы, не стесняйтесь оставлять комментарии.
Как принудительно установить версии вашего веб-сайта с www или без www с помощью .htaccess
Как принудительно настроить версии вашего веб-сайта с www или без www с помощью .htaccess
База знаний Главная / Как принудительно установить версии вашего веб-сайта с www или без www с помощью правил .htaccess
// Просмотр комментариев //
Чтобы заставить ваш веб-сайт использовать версии с «www» или «без www», просто используйте приведенный ниже код в файле .htaccess в корневом каталоге public_html ИЛИ в местоположении основных файлов вашего веб-сайта. Вам может понадобиться создать файл .htaccess (он же точка htaccess) 9(.*)$ http://yourdomain.com/$1 [L,R=301]
Примечание: Если у вас есть CMS, такая как WordPress или Joomla, вам необходимо убедиться, что настройки вашего веб-сайта находятся на панели инструментов. отражает приведенные выше правила, которые вы используете.
Если у вас есть какие-либо вопросы по веб-хостингу, свяжитесь с нами по телефону . Мы рады помочь.
- Предоставление последовательных, стабильных и надежных услуг веб-хостинга.
- Обеспечьте быстрое реагирование на заявки и быстрое решение проблем.
- Никогда не перенасыщайте серверы и не выделяйте их слишком много, чтобы обеспечить стабильность и скорость для наших клиентов.
- Используйте только высококачественное оборудование корпоративного класса, чтобы обеспечить минимальное время простоя из-за аппаратных сбоев.
- Укажите четкие цены без скрытых комиссий и подвохов.
Блоги, информационный бюллетень и обновления
Подпишитесь на наши информационные бюллетени и получайте обновления, специальные предложения и новый контент.
Статьи по теме
- Как отключить SSH-вход для пользователя root
- Как сбросить пароль администратора для NextCloud
- Установите CSF (ConfigServer Security & Firewall) через SSH на CentOS 7
- Как установить MySQL на CentOS 7
- Начало работы с учетной записью реселлера хостинга
- Как выполнить трассировку в Windows Linux и OSX
- Выделенные IP-адреса
- Редактирование зоны DNS с помощью редактора зон DNS в WHM
- Как проверить свой веб-сайт на наличие неработающих ссылок в WordPress
Ссылки, ведущие к недоступным местам назначения, называются «неработающими ссылками». Эти ссылки могут быть результатом ошибок программирования, неправильного написания URL-адресов, ссылок в сообщениях или удаления страниц из вашей панели управления WordPress. Broken Link Checker — эффективный плагин для обнаружения битых ссылок в режиме реального времени. С настраиваемыми временными интервалами и выборочным
Продолжить чтение…
- Как заменить задание WordPress Cron реальным заданием Cron
Ваше медленное время загрузки WordPress или неудачные запланированные публикации могут быть вызваны функцией cron WordPress по умолчанию. вы можете заменить его заданием cron операционной системы (Unix/Linux) для повышения производительности. Фактическое задание cron — это планировщик cron, который представляет собой системный процесс, который автоматически выполняет задачи для вас в соответствии с
Подробнее…
- Как настроить Redis Object Cache в WordPress
Существует ряд плагинов, которые позволяют настроить Redis как Object Cache для вашего веб-сайта WordPress, тем самым повышая его производительность. В этой статье мы обсудим LiteSpeed Cache для WordPress, также известный как LSCWP, и плагины Redis Object Cache. Перед началом этого руководства предполагается, что Redis включен в cPanel. Если нет,
Продолжить чтение…
- Как включить кэш объектов Redis для использования на вашем веб-сайте
Читать далее…
- Учебники по phpMyAdmin
Работа с базами данных в phpMyAdmin Посмотреть это видео на YouTube Как управлять базой данных MySQL с помощью phpMyAdmin в cPanel Посмотреть это видео на YouTube Как удалить поля из таблиц с помощью phpMyAdmin Посмотреть это видео на YouTube Как изменить поля в таблицах с помощью phpMyAdmin Посмотреть это видео на YouTube
Продолжить чтение. ..
.htaccess и www — без www | SEO Форум
Ваш браузер не поддерживает JavaScript. В результате ваши впечатления от просмотра будут уменьшены, и вы были помещены в режим только для чтения .
Загрузите браузер, поддерживающий JavaScript, или включите его, если он отключен (например, NoScript).
- Дом
- SEO-тактика
- Техническое SEO
- .
htaccess и www — без www
Эта тема была удалена. Его могут видеть только пользователи с правами управления вопросами.
-
Недавно я завладел веб-сайтом и совершил колоссальную ошибку. Сайт был правильно построен через .htaccess к домену www. Обычно я катаюсь без него, и я сделал неверное предположение, что .htaccess ранее был установлен неправильно, потому что были сотни фундаментальных ошибок.
Через пару дней я заметил ошибку, но некоторые из наших новых (не www) получили несколько устойчивых ссылок и т. д. Так что теперь я чувствую, что нахожусь в кошмаре с созданием переадресаций и т. д. Так что я должен переключиться обратно на WWW или нет? Имеет ли это значение в данный момент?
org/Comment»> подходит в любом случае, но не в обоих.
-
Спасибо, ребята. Я был почти уверен, что это то, что я должен был сделать, но всегда так полезно в затруднительном положении получить экспертное мнение.
Еще раз спасибо!!
Барри все сказал.
Вы получите 90% ссылочного веса существующих обратных ссылок, так что просто дерзайте.
Я рекомендую вам 301-перенаправить все страницы без «www». на полные URL-адреса, содержащие «www.».-
В какой-то момент вы почти наверняка захотите определить его так или иначе.
Да, вы потеряете немного силы из-за перенаправлений, как только вы их сделаете, но, по крайней мере, после этого вы можете быть уверены, что все ссылки будут указывать на нужное место.
Вам лучше иметь 90+% к одному или 50% к каждому — вот в чем вопрос
Спасибо за ответ. Дубликатов данных нет. Я очень уверен в этом, и я правильно сконструировал 301 для правильной канонической ссылки. Я должен был изложить вопрос немного лучше. Я четко определен насквозь к НЕ-WWW-адресу, но большинство входящих ссылок ведут на WWW-ссылку и имеют к ним 301. Похоже, что мне не хватает ссылочного сока из ссылок.
У вас есть животрепещущий вопрос по SEO?
Подпишитесь на Moz Pro, чтобы получить полный доступ к вопросам и ответам, отвечать на вопросы и задавать свои.
Начать бесплатную пробную версию
Есть вопрос?
Просмотр вопросов
Посмотреть Все вопросыНовые (нет ответов)ОбсуждениеОтветыПоддержка продуктаБез ответа
От Все времяПоследние 30 днейПоследние 7 днейПоследние 24 часа
Сортировка по Последние вопросыНедавняя активностьБольше всего лайковБольшинство ответовМеньше всего ответовСамые старые вопросы
С категорией All CategoriesAffiliate MarketingAlgorithm UpdatesAPIBrandingCommunityCompetitive ResearchContent DevelopmentConversion Rate OptimizationDigital MarketingFeature RequestsGetting StartedImage & Video OptimizationIndustry EventsIndustry NewsIntermediate & Advanced SEOInternational SEOJobs and OpportunitiesKeyword ExplorerKeyword ResearchLink BuildingLink ExplorerLocal ListingsLocal SEOLocal Website OptimizationMoz BarMoz LocalMoz NewsMoz ProMoz ToolsOn-Page OptimizationOther SEO ToolsPaid Search MarketingProduct SupportReporting & AnalyticsResearch & TrendsReviews and RatingsSearch BehaviorSEO ТактикаТренды поисковой выдачиСоциальные сетиТехническое SEOВеб-дизайнБелое/черное SEO
Связанные вопросы
Привет, сообщество Moz! Я новичок в SEO, Moz, и это мой первый вопрос. Мои вопросы; У меня есть клиент, который помечен как повторяющийся контент. Его помечают за наличие двух доменов с одинаковым контентом, т. е. www.mysite.com и mysite.com. Я прочитал это и настроил переадресацию 301 через свой хостинг. Я оценил, у какого сайта более высокий авторитет страницы, и какой из более слабых сайтов перенаправляется на более сильный сайт. Тем не менее, я все еще получаю сообщения о повторяющихся страницах, вызванных тем, что www. mysite.com и mysite.com являются дубликатами. Как мне решить эту проблему? Является ли это примером тега Canonical, необходимого в заголовке HTML? Любое направление приветствуется. Спасибо. Б/Р Уилл Х.
Техническое SEO | | Маркетингшимпанзе10
0
Здравствуйте, Я работаю с клиентом, который создает новый сайт. В настоящее время они используют следующую структуру URL: http://clientname.com/products/furry-cat-muffins/ Но целевая страница для каталога /products/ на самом деле не имеет никакого контента. У них есть аналогичная проблема с каталогом /about/, где меню фактически отправляет вас в /about/our-story/ вместо /about/. Вредит ли SEO такая структура URL-адресов, а также имеет ли смысл создавать 301 редиректы с /about/ на /about/our-story/?
Техническое SEO | | Ольха
0
Например, мой сайт имеет mysite.com/randomunusedpage.html С веб-сайта на эту страницу не ведут никакие ссылки, но она опубликована (пришла с темой WP). Не повредит ли это моему SEO и стоит ли мне удалять страницу или это безвредно? Спасибо
Техническое SEO | | Чудесный
0
У меня технический вопрос, Например, сайт A был оштрафован обновлениями Google, panda и penguin, а сайт b находится в той же нише, работает хорошо и никогда не подвергался наказанию обновлениями. Если я перенаправлю сайт А на сайт Б с кодом состояния 301 (постоянная переадресация), будет ли Google наказывать сайт Б также? потому что штрафы перемещаются со старого домена на новый в соответствии с алгоритмами Google. И если да, то как я могу помешать моему конкуренту удалить перенаправление оштрафованного домена на мой?
Техническое SEO | | хаммадрафик
0
org/ListItem»> .htaccess и ошибка 404Привет, Я разрешаю связаться с сообществом снова, потому что у вас есть хороший и быстрый ответ! Вчера я потерял файл .htaccess на своем сервере. Сейчас работает только домашняя страница, а остальные страницы выдают такое сообщение: Не найдено Запрошенный URL-адрес /freshadmin/user/login/ не найден на этом сервере. Не могли бы вы мне помочь, пожалуйста? Спасибо
Техническое SEO | | Probikeshop
0
Канонические URL-адреса (и все наши усилия по созданию ссылок) находятся на www-версии сайта. Однако на сайте возникла серьезная техническая проблема, и необходимо перенаправить некоторые ссылки (некоторые из которых очень важны) с версии www на версию сайта без www (для этих страниц канонической ссылкой по-прежнему является версия с www). Насколько велика проблема SEO? Не могли бы вы объяснить точные опасности SEO? Спасибо!
Техническое SEO | | theLotter
0
В течение месяца я запускаю новый интернет-магазин о специях и кофе. Думаю доменное имя взять. Я хотел бы получить посетителей от поиска кофе и специй по ключевым словам.